Intended Use

Ortho-mune OKT4A (CD4) Monoclonal Antibody (Murine) FITC Conjugate is used to identify and enumerate the percentage of CD4+ human T lymphocytes in whole blood by flow cytometry. Identification and enumeration of abnormal levels of CD4 lymphocytes may be clinically significant in the prognosis of secondary immunodeficiency diseases (acquired immunodeficiency syndrome [AIDS]). AIDS is characterized by a severe reduction in T helper (CD3+CD4+) lymphocytes and a decrease in the CD4:CD8 ratio. The CD4:CD8 ratio has been used as a predictor of time to the development of AIDS. CD4 counts should also be determined using a CD3/CD4 combination reagent to eliminate monocyte contamination (CD3-CD4+dim). CD4+lymphocytes (expressed as an absolute number, a percentage of lymphocytes or as a ratio of CD4+ to CD8+ T lymphocytes) represents the best single predictor of the progression of AIDS. CD4+ lymphocyte numbers usually start to decline relatively soon after human immunodeficiency virus (HIV) infection.

Device Story

Ortho-mune OKT4A (CD4) FITC Conjugate is a murine monoclonal antibody conjugated to fluorescein isothiocyanate (FITC). It is used in clinical laboratories by trained personnel to stain whole blood samples. The reagent binds to CD4+ T lymphocytes, which are then detected and enumerated using a flow cytometer (e.g., ORTHO CYTORONABSOLUTE). The device provides quantitative data on the percentage of CD4+ cells. Clinicians use these results to assess the progression of HIV/AIDS, as CD4+ lymphocyte counts are a primary predictor of disease status. The device aids in clinical decision-making by providing objective measurements of immune cell populations, helping monitor patients with immunodeficiency.

Clinical Evidence

Clinical performance evaluated at three external sites using 206 normal donors and 88 AIDS/ARC patients. Comparison against predicate device showed equivalent mean percentages of CD4+ cells. Within-laboratory and between-laboratory reproducibility studies (N=10) demonstrated low coefficients of variation (CV) across low, normal, and high CD4 concentrations. Linearity studies confirmed performance across a range of 20 to 9000 cells/uL with slopes near 1.0 and R values of 1.000.

Regulatory Classification

Identification

An automated differential cell counter is a device used to identify one or more of the formed elements of the blood. The device may also have the capability to flag, count, or classify immature or abnormal hematopoietic cells of the blood, bone marrow, or other body fluids. These devices may combine an electronic particle counting method, optical method, or a flow cytometric method utilizing monoclonal CD (cluster designation) markers. The device includes accessory CD markers.

No. K951459 - Submitted July, 1997 # WITHIN-LABORATORY REPRODUCIBILITY Ten normal donors were used in a within-laboratory reproducibility study at three independent laboratories. The samples were processed using antibody-coated magnetic microbeads to produce low, normal and high percent positive CD4 populations to simulate leukopenia and leukocytosis. The samples were stained with Ortho-mune OKT4A (CD4) FITC Conjugate and run on the ORTHO CYTORONABSOLUTE. All samples were analyzed in replicates of ten. The coefficients of variation, calculated from the standard deviation between replicates, were compared and demonstrated excellent within-laboratory reproducibility at all concentrations tested. The 95% confidence intervals were calculated from the standard error of the site mean which includes variance components from replicate and donor variability minimized by the number of donors (10). The comparison of normal, concentrated (high) and diluted (low) samples is contained in Table 3. | TABLE 3: N = 10 WITHIN-LABORATORY REPRODUCIBILITY Ortho-mune OKT4A (CD4) FITC CONJUGATE PERCENT POSITIVE RESULTS | | | | | | | | | | | --- | --- | --- | --- | --- | --- | --- | --- | --- | --- | | CD4 Level | Low | | | Normal | | | High | | | | Subset: OKT4A (CD4) | Site 1 | Site 2 | Site 3 | Site 1 | Site 2 | Site 3 | Site 1 | Site 2 | Site 3 | | Mean Percent Positive | 9.60 | 9.36 | 8.86 | 47.38 | 47.19 | 48.54 | 56.13 | 55.83 | 56.50 | | CV | 7.60 | 6.12 | 5.47 | 2.33 | 2.00 | 2.21 | 1.93 | 1.79 | 2.09 | | +/- 95% Confidence Interval | 4.18 | 3.53 | 3.45 | 3.74 | 3.84 | 4.22 | 4.93 | 4.91 | 5.15 | c:\data\word\CD4 Page 4 {4} Ortho Diagnostic Systems Inc. No. K951459 - Submitted July, 1997 A linearity study was performed using an automated hematology analyzer to determine total lymphocyte count, and the CYTORONABSOLUTE flow cytometer to determine the percent positive CDx cells. Specimens from four normal donors (whole blood, EDTA) were processed to produce samples with low, normal and high numbers of lymphocyte subsets. Each whole blood specimen was concentrated by harvesting the buffy coat to obtain a white blood cell count between 20,000 and 40,000 cells/ul and then diluting to produce samples of high, normal and low numbers of lymphocyte subsets. A portion of each sample was stained in triplicate using Ortho-mune OKT4A (CD4) FITC Conjugate immunophenotyping reagent and analyzed using the CYTORONABSOLUTE flow cytometer. The total lymphocyte count of the concentrated sample for each donor was obtained using an automated hematology analyzer. Linear regression analyses were performed as follows. The expected (X axis) values were calculated by multiplying the corresponding serial dilutions by the hematology analyzer derived buffy coat lymphocyte count and by the CYTORONABSOLUTE derived lymphocyte subset percent positive. The observed (Y axis) values were determined as the total lymphocyte count calculated from the hematology derived value of the concentrated sample times the CYTORONABSOLUTE derived lymphocyte subset percent positive at each dilution. The Ortho-mune OKT4A (CD4) FITC Conjugate reagent demonstrated linear performance for total CD4+ lymphocyte subsets across a lymphocyte count range of 20 cells/uL to 9000 cells/uL as demonstrated with slopes indistinguishable from 1 and R values of 1.000.
